|Description=Characters have weird shadows and odd colors.
|Description=Characters have weird shadows and odd colors.
|Workaround=Issue has been fixed on 1.5 dev builds. Use OpenGL renderer and make sure Blending Accuracy is set to at least Basic level. For Direct3D11 as it lacks Blending you can enable Auto Flush hw hack but it will have a drastic hit on performance, otherwise switch to software rendering. You can also effectively turn shadows off in hardware mode by going to Config > Video > Plugin Settings > Advanced Settings and Hacks and then set Skipdraw Range to 1/1. This solves the shadow bug without having to use the performance costly Auto Flush option.
